Prove that the two equations shown below are equivalent.​

F = ma and F = p/t​

Newton’s Second Law of Motion is defined as Force is equal to the rate of change of momentum. For a constant mass, force equals mass times acceleration.

[tex]\Delta p = mv - mu \\\\\implies \Delta p = m(v-u) \\\\F = \dfrac{\Delta p}{\Delta t} = \dfrac{m(v-u)}{\Delta t} = ma[/tex]
